Book on rise of AAP, Arvind Kejriwal

A book for the first time has analysed the rise of the AAP and its leader Arvind Kejriwal and the highs and lows of the party that made a stunning debut in last December's Delhi assembly election.

The book "The Disrupter: Arvind Kejriwal and the Audacious Rise of the Aam Aadmi" (Rupa) written by journalists Gautam Chikermane and Soma Banerjee traces the journey of the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) that surprised everyone with its 28-seat victory in the election to the 70-member assembly in December 2013 to Kejriwal's 49-day stint as the Delhi chief minister.

The journalist duo also interviewed Kejriwal and other prominent AAP members like Yogendra Yadav, Gopal Rai, Atishi Marlena, and Praveen Singh.
